Itinerary
- Day 1 – Arrive Ho Chi Minh City, My Tho, Embark Ship, Cai Be:
Your journey begins today amid the vibrant bustle of Ho Chi Minh City. Upon arrival, be met at the airport and transferred to your ship. Travel to My Tho, where you will board your boutique river ship, the RV Lotus, your home for the next seven nights. Soak in the scenery as you cruise towards Cai Be, where the ship will anchor overnight. Tonight, enjoy a special Welcome Dinner on board and get to know your crew and fellow travellers.
- Day 2 – Cai Be, Sa Dec, Tan Chau:
Explore Cai Be and its surrounds by tender boat as you view local life on the river and along its banks. Go ashore to see the Cai Be Church, the tallest church in the Mekong Delta with its impressive bell tower, and visit manufacturers of rice paper and coconut candy to learn how they’re made. Head back to the ship and sit down to a delicious lunch while cruising to Sa Dec. Afterwards, take a boat ride to the charming town of Sa Dec for a guided tour. Stroll through the colourful markets and continue by foot to the home of Huynh Thuy Le, once the lover of French writer Marguerite Duras, whose best-selling novel The Lover offers a fictionalised account of their affair. Back on board, unwind or relax your body with a rejuvenating treatment from the spa. As the sun sets, the RV Lotus sets sail for Tan Chau. Enjoy dinner and later, head up to the Saigon Lounge for evening entertainment or a cocktail.
- Day 3 – Tan Chau, Cambodia Border Crossing, Phnom Penh:
Transfer to a small boat for a journey along the tiny tributaries that snake around Tan Chau. Disembark for a rickshaw tour and visit a local rattan weaving workshop. After lunch, take a small boat to discover authentic rural life on Evergreen Island. Observe traditional Vietnamese farming techniques, where the land is ploughed by water buffalo. Later, appreciate some downtime and watch the scenery of the Mekong River pass by as the RV Lotus cruises towards the Cambodian border. While border formalities are carried out, sit down and enjoy the onboard activities and presentations. Cross into Cambodia and cruise overnight towards the capital, Phnom Penh.
- Day 4 – Phnom Penh:
Today, learn of the atrocities inflicted upon Cambodians during Pol Pot’s Khmer Rouge regime in the 1970s. Explore the Tuol Sleng Genocide Museum and the Killing Fields, where you’ll find the Memorial Stupa, a glass monument erected in memory of the thousands of Cambodians who lost their lives. After lunch on board, visit the spectacular Royal Palace, delighting in its dazzling white and gold architecture. Then, head to the glorious Silver Pagoda, set on the southern side of the palace complex. The remainder of the afternoon is at your leisure. You may wish to head to the local markets for souvenirs or perhaps to taste the local delicacy of fried tarantula. Alternatively, relax on board and enjoy the facilities and service.
- Day 5 – Phnom Penh, Oudong, Koh Chen:
Begin your morning with an excursion by road to Oudong, Cambodia’s royal capital from the early 17th until the 19th centuries. Here, enjoy a memorable Insider Experience. En route back to Phnom Penh, take a leisurely walk to explore Koh Chen, a village specialising in the manufacture of copperware. Visit some small family workshops and perhaps purchase some souvenirs. Insider Experience – Buddhist Blessing Ceremony
Take part in a traditional Buddhist blessing ceremony to wish you good luck, health and safe journey, led by resident monks at a monastery in Oudong.
Enhance Your Journey – Hands-On Cooking Workshop
Meet your chef and visit a local market to select fruits, spices and other local ingredients before learning how to prepare authentic Khmer dishes.
Enhance Your Journey – Phnom Penh by Cyclo
Explore Phnom Penh by cyclo, taking in sights such as Independence Square, the Royal Palace, trendy cafes, boutiques, local markets, and pagodas.
Enhance Your Journey – Phnom Penh by Tuk Tuk
Discover Phnom Penh by tuk tuk, passing sights like Wat Phnom, the Phnom Penh Post Office, U.S. Embassy, Raffles Hotel, and Royal Railway Station. Ride along Pasteur Street, the Central Market, and Phsar Tapang. Stop to walk around the Independence Monument and statue of King Norodom Sihanouk, then continue past NagaWorld, the Royal Palace and Sisowath Quay.
- Day 6 – Phnom Penh, Oknha Tey, Angkor Ban:
Rise early as your ship glides along the lush banks of the Mekong to Oknha Tey (Oknha Tei), or Silk Island. The river island is renowned for its silk manufacturing traditions, preserved over centuries. Travel by tuk tuk past rice fields and get a glimpse into rural life. Stroll among the stilt houses and gain an insight into the traditional silk weaving process. Watch as the village women create beautiful Khmer fabrics from their wooden looms. Return to your river ship and savour lunch on board as the ship sets sail for Angkor Ban. As you cruise up the Mekong River in the afternoon, enjoy time at leisure. Take a dip in the pool or sit and read a book on the Sun Deck while soaking in the scenery.
- Day 7 – Angkor Ban, Koh Pen, Kampong Cham:
Start your morning with a guided walk of Angkor Ban, a village awash with stories of Cambodia’s cultural history, and one of the few traditional villages that survived the Khmer Rouge regime. Stroll through the town – nicknamed the ‘Lucky Village’ – to see traditional stilted houses and a Khmer-style pagoda. After lunch, your cruise docks at its final location, Kampong Cham, where you can enjoy your Insider Experience. This evening, enjoy a Farewell Dinner on board with your fellow travellers as you reminisce about your Mekong River cruise adventure.
Insider Experience – Tuk Tuk Tour of Koh Pen
Hop on a tuk tuk and explore the agricultural island of Koh Pen. Travel along the shaded lanes and past wooden stilted houses, tucked among palm and sandalwood trees.
- Day 8 – Kampong Cham, Disembark Ship, Depart Siem Reap:
Disembark in Kampong Cham after breakfast and transfer to Siem Reap. In due time, transfer to Siem Reap–Angkor International Airport for your onward flight.
